Man of the match Kekuta Manneh, F, Crew SC: Had goal and assist in his first three minutes off the bench

Game summary

Montreal 1 0—1 Columbus 1 3—4 First half: 1, Columbus, Higuain, 7, 17th minute. 2, Montreal, Jackson-Hamel, 5 (Dzemaili), 19th.

Second half: 3, Columbus, Manneh, 1 (Kamara), 70th. 4, Columbus, Kamara, 9 (Manneh), 72nd. 5, Columbus, Higuain, 8 (Jahn), 88th. Yellow Cards: Fisher, Montreal, 16th; Camara, Montreal, 34th; Meram, Columbus, 46th; Afful, Columbus, 78th. A: 16,592 Lineups: Montreal— Bush; Camara ( Salazar, 76th), Ciman, Duvall, Fisher, Lefevre; Bernardell­o, Donadel ( Tabla, 73rd), Dzemaili, Piatti; JacksonHam­el ( Mancosu, 54th). Bernardell­o played ahead to recently acquired Swiss midfielder Blerim Dzemaili, who found an open Anthony JacksonHam­el to his right.

Jackson-Hamel swiftly beat Crew goalkeeper Zack Steffen for his fifth goal of the season, drawing the Impact even at 1-1 in the 19th minute.

The Montreal goal came on its only shot on target in the first half, but there were additional scary moments for the Crew SC defense. In the 33rd minute, a poorly hit clearance by Jonathan Mensah sailed directly to Dzemaili in the center of the box. Dzemaili didn’t get a second touch, however, as Steffen came off his line to smother the ball.

Crew SC wraps up a two-game homestand Saturday night against Atlanta United. Atlanta defeated Crew SC 3-1 last Saturday.
